1. บทนำ
เมื่อใช้ Ubuntu บางครั้งคุณอาจต้องตรวจสอบที่อยู่ IP ของคุณ เช่น การแก้ไขปัญหาการเชื่อมต่อเครือข่ายหรือการจัดการเซิร์ฟเวอร์ ที่อยู่ IP เป็นข้อมูลสำคัญที่ใช้ระบุอุปกรณ์บนอินเทอร์เน็ตหรือเครือข่ายภายในบทความนี้อธิบายวิธีต่าง ๆ ในการตรวจสอบที่อยู่ IP บน Ubuntu อย่างชัดเจน เหมาะสำหรับผู้เริ่มต้นและผู้ใช้ระดับสูง
2. ที่อยู่ IP คืออะไร?
ที่อยู่ IP คือหมายเลขที่ไม่ซ้ำกันใช้ระบุคอมพิวเตอร์และอุปกรณ์บนอินเทอร์เน็ตหรือภายในเครือข่ายท้องถิ่น ทุกอุปกรณ์ที่เชื่อมต่อกับอินเทอร์เน็ตจะได้รับที่อยู่ IP ซึ่งจำเป็นต่อการสื่อสารกับเครือข่ายภายนอก มีที่อยู่ IP สองประเภท:
- Public IP Address : ที่อยู่ที่ใช้ระบุอุปกรณ์บนอินเทอร์เน็ต ให้โดยผู้ให้บริการอินเทอร์เน็ต (ISP) และใช้สำหรับการเข้าถึงจากภายนอก
- Private IP Address : ที่อยู่ที่ใช้ภายในเครือข่ายท้องถิ่น เช่น ในบ้านหรือสำนักงาน ไม่สามารถเข้าถึงโดยตรงจากอินเทอร์เน็ตและใช้สำหรับการสื่อสารภายในระหว่างอุปกรณ์
นอกจากนี้ ที่อยู่ IP ยังสามารถแบ่งเป็น dynamic หรือ static อีกด้วย ที่อยู่ IP แบบไดนามิกจะเปลี่ยนแปลงทุกครั้งที่อุปกรณ์เชื่อมต่อกับเครือข่าย ส่วนที่อยู่ IP แบบสเตติกจะถูกกำหนดด้วยตนเองและไม่เปลี่ยนแปลง
3. การตรวจสอบที่อยู่ IP ด้วยบรรทัดคำสั่ง
วิธีที่มีประสิทธิภาพที่สุดในการตรวจสอบที่อยู่ IP บน Ubuntu คือผ่านเทอร์มินัล วิธีนี้มีประโยชน์เป็นพิเศษในสภาพแวดล้อมเซิร์ฟเวอร์หรือเมื่อทำงานจากระยะไกล
1. ใช้คำสั่ง ip
คุณสามารถแสดงข้อมูลเครือข่ายรวมถึงที่อยู่ IP ได้โดยรันคำสั่งต่อไปนี้:
ip addr show
ผลลัพธ์จะแสดงอินเทอร์เฟซเครือข่ายหลายตัว โดยแต่ละตัวจะแสดงที่อยู่ IPv4 และ IPv6 บรรทัดที่มี inet แสดงที่อยู่ IPv4 ส่วน inet6 แสดงที่อยู่ IPv6
หากต้องการแสดงข้อมูล IP อย่างกระชับเท่านั้น ให้ใช้ตัวเลือก -br:
ip -br addr
2. ใช้คำสั่ง ifconfig
ในเวอร์ชัน Linux เก่า คำสั่ง ifconfig ถูกใช้เพื่อตรวจสอบที่อยู่ IP บน Ubuntu เวอร์ชันใหม่คุณต้องติดตั้ง net-tools ก่อนจึงจะใช้ได้
sudo apt install net-tools
ifconfig
การรันคำสั่งนี้จะแสดงข้อมูลรายละเอียดของแต่ละอินเทอร์เฟซ
4. การตรวจสอบผ่าน GUI (Graphical User Interface)
สำหรับผู้เริ่มต้นหรือผู้ที่ไม่คุ้นเคยกับบรรทัดคำสั่ง Ubuntu ยังมีวิธีตรวจสอบที่อยู่ IP ผ่าน GUI ที่เป็นภาพและใช้งานง่าย เหมาะกับผู้ใช้เดสก์ท็อปหลายคน
ขั้นตอนที่ 1: เปิดการตั้งค่าเครือข่าย
บนเดสก์ท็อป Ubuntu ให้คลิกไอคอนเครือข่ายที่มุมขวาบนของหน้าจอ แล้วเลือก “Network Settings”
ขั้นตอนที่ 2: ดูข้อมูลรายละเอียด
ในหน้าต่าง Network Settings ให้เลือกการเชื่อมต่อเครือข่ายที่กำลังใช้งาน (Wi‑Fi หรือสาย) แล้วคลิก “Connection Information” ที่นี่คุณจะเห็นที่อยู่ IPv4 และ IPv6 ทั้งสองแบบ

5. วิธีตรวจสอบ Public IP Address ของคุณ
Public IP Address ใช้ระบุอุปกรณ์ของคุณบนอินเทอร์เน็ต มอบให้โดย ISP และทำให้เซิร์ฟเวอร์หรือบริการอื่น ๆ สามารถรับรู้อุปกรณ์ของคุณได้
คำสั่งเพื่อตรวจสอบ
คุณสามารถแสดง Public IP Address ได้อย่างง่ายดายโดยรันคำสั่งต่อไปนี้:
curl ifconfig.me
คำสั่งนี้จะแสดงที่อยู่ IP สาธารณะที่มองเห็นได้จากอินเทอร์เน็ต
6. ความแตกต่างระหว่าง Public และ Private IP Address
การเข้าใจความแตกต่างระหว่าง Public และ Private IP Address จะช่วยเพิ่มความรู้ด้านเครือข่ายของคุณ
- Public IP Address : มองเห็นได้โดยผู้ใช้และบริการอื่น ๆ บนอินเทอร์เน็ต ทำให้สามารถเข้าถึงจากภายนอกได้ เช่น เว็บเซิร์ฟเวอร์, เกมออนไลน์, การเชื่อมต่อระยะไกล
- Private IP Address : ใช้ภายในเครือข่ายบ้านหรือองค์กร ไม่สามารถเข้าถึงโดยตรงจากอินเทอร์เน็ต อุปกรณ์เช่น PC และเครื่องพิมพ์ใช้ที่อยู่นี้สำหรับการสื่อสารภายใน
7. สรุป
บทความนี้แนะนำวิธีต่าง ๆ ในการตรวจสอบที่อยู่ IP ของคุณบน Ubuntu โดยใช้บรรทัดคำสั่งและเครื่องมือ GUI วิธีที่ใช้ GUI แนะนำสำหรับผู้เริ่มต้น ในขณะที่เครื่องมือบรรทัดคำสั่งเหมาะสำหรับผู้ดูแลเซิร์ฟเวอร์และผู้ทำงานระยะไกล ใช้วิธีที่เหมาะกับสภาพแวดล้อมของคุณเพื่อเช็คที่อยู่ IP อย่างรวดเร็วและแก้ไขปัญหาเครือข่ายอย่างมีประสิทธิภาพ
8. คำถามที่พบบ่อย (FAQ)
Q1: ทำไมจึงมีที่อยู่ IP หลายรายการ?
A: หากอุปกรณ์ของคุณมีหลายอินเทอร์เฟซเครือข่าย (เช่น Wi‑Fi และการเชื่อมต่อแบบสาย) แต่ละอินเทอร์เฟซอาจมีที่อยู่ IP ของตนเอง.
Q2: ฉันจะเปลี่ยนที่อยู่ IP ของฉันได้อย่างไร?
A: เพื่อกำหนดค่าที่อยู่ IP แบบคงที่ ให้แก้ไขการตั้งค่า netplan ของคุณด้วยตนเองและรัน sudo netplan apply.
Q3: ฉันจะทำให้ที่อยู่ IP สาธารณะของฉันเป็นส่วนตัวได้อย่างไร?
A: การใช้ VPN จะซ่อนที่อยู่ IP สาธารณะของคุณและช่วยปกป้องความเป็นส่วนตัวของคุณออนไลน์.


